At Midnight on August 2, Watermarking Stopped Being Optional
There was no press conference in Sacramento. Just after midnight on Sunday, August 2, a single line in the California code quietly switched on, and a cluster of statutes filed under Business and Professions Code section 22757 and following — the ones everyone calls the California AI Transparency Act — became operative. The law itself had been sitting on the books since Governor Gavin Newsom signed it in September 2024. What was missing was the date on which anybody actually had to obey it. That date arrived over the weekend, and as of yesterday, not obeying it costs money.
Here's the deal in numbers. If you built a generative AI system that draws more than one million monthly visitors or users and is publicly accessible in California, you now owe the state three things. A free, publicly accessible detection tool that lets anyone check whether a piece of content came out of your system. A user-facing option to stamp a visible "this is AI" label onto generated output. And an embedded, machine-readable latent watermark inside every image, video, and audio file your model produces. Miss any of it and you're looking at $5,000 per violation — with each day of continued violation counted as its own separate violation. That last clause is where the teeth are. Five thousand dollars is a rounding error for a frontier lab. Five thousand dollars multiplied by the number of non-compliant assets multiplied by the number of days is a different conversation entirely.
And the August 2 date is not an accident. The original operative date was January 1, 2026. Then AB 853, signed October 13, 2025, pushed it to August 2 — the exact day the European Union's AI Act transparency obligations under Article 50 came into application. California synced its regulatory clock to Brussels. For a single U.S. state to align its compliance calendar with the EU's is a genuinely notable moment in regulatory geography, and for corporate compliance teams it reads as a deliberate nudge: two jurisdictions, one deadline, do the work once.

Who's Actually Standing on This Board
Start with the author. State Senator Josh Becker wrote SB 942, and the geography is delicious: his district covers a chunk of Silicon Valley. A legislator who lives in the AI industry's backyard is the one who made the AI industry embed watermarks. In August 2024, his office put out a release announcing that the tech industry had dropped its opposition to the bill entirely, saying the negotiated version addressed industry concerns while preserving the bill's core objectives. The expansion into AB 853 came from Assemblymember Buffy Wicks, who pushed a far more ambitious version that dragged social platforms and camera manufacturers into scope — and got most of it.
On the other side of the table sat the trade associations. TechNet, NetChoice, the Computer and Communications Industry Association (CCIA), and the California Chamber of Commerce formed the original opposition bloc. Their argument came in two flavors. First: this is a problem for a uniform federal standard, not fifty state standards. Second: content provenance and watermarking are immature technologies, and it's premature to freeze them into prescriptive statute. That second point was, honestly, not wrong in 2024 — watermarks routinely died to a single screenshot or a JPEG recompression. The coalition withdrew opposition after negotiations in August 2024. Chamber of Progress held out and sent the Governor a letter asking him to veto the bill anyway.
Now the enforcers, and this part matters more than people notice. Enforcement runs through the California Attorney General, but also through city attorneys and county counsel. Distributed enforcement authority at the municipal level is unusual in U.S. AI regulation. Layer on top of that the fee-shifting provision — a prevailing plaintiff can recover attorney's fees and costs — and you get a structure where the City Attorney of Los Angeles can independently decide to make an example of a generative AI company and recoup the cost of doing so. Distributed enforcement makes outcomes less predictable, but it makes the pressure a lot broader.
The technical protagonist here isn't a person, it's a standard. C2PA — the Coalition for Content Provenance and Authenticity — and its Content Credentials specification function as the de facto default the statute points at without naming. The bill text doesn't say "C2PA" anywhere, but the language about widely accepted industry standards lands squarely on it. C2PA launched its Conformance Program and official Trust List in mid-2025, so there's now a public registry of products that have actually passed testing rather than just claimed membership. Sitting alongside it is pixel-level watermarking, most prominently Google DeepMind's SynthID, which acts as the fallback layer when metadata gets stripped.
And finally the regulated. OpenAI, Google, Meta, Adobe, and Midjourney are the names that keep surfacing. OpenAI announced on May 19, 2026 that it had become C2PA-conformant and was adding SynthID invisible watermarking, shipping a public research-preview tool at openai.com/verify that checks uploaded images for supported provenance signals. The timing reads like preparation for exactly this deadline. Google has SynthID verification live in Gemini and says it's expanding to Search and Chrome. Midjourney, by contrast, was reported by at least one outlet to have reached the operative date with no C2PA credentials and no known pixel watermark — that's single-outlet reporting and the company hasn't publicly confirmed its posture, so treat it as an open question rather than a settled fact.
What the Law Actually Demands — Three Duties and One Big Hole
Duty one is the detection tool. The statute requires a covered provider to make available an AI detection tool "at no cost to the user" that is publicly accessible. It has to let a user assess whether content was created or altered by that provider's generative AI system, output system provenance data, and do all of that without exposing personal information. It also has to support both direct upload and API access. This is the single most distinctive thing about the California approach. The EU AI Act tells you to disclose. California tells you to disclose and to build and operate the verification infrastructure on your own dime. That's a materially heavier lift than labeling, and it's the part that will cost engineering teams the most.
Duty two is the manifest disclosure — the visible one. Note carefully what the statute says: providers must give users the option to include a visible disclosure. This is not a mandatory watermark burned onto every image. It's a mandatory feature. When present, the disclosure has to identify the content as AI-generated and be "clear, conspicuous, appropriate for the medium of the content, and understandable to a reasonable person." The optionality is a fingerprint of the 2024 negotiation. Industry argued that forced visible labels wreck product experience; the legislature settled for requiring the capability. In practice, a toggle in the export dialog satisfies it. But if the toggle isn't there, you're in violation.
Duty three is the latent disclosure, and this one has no opt-out. Every image, video, and audio output has to carry embedded, machine-readable information conveying the name of the covered provider, the name and version of the system, the time and date of creation, and a unique identifier — either directly or through a permanent link to that information. And the statute says the disclosure must be "permanent or extraordinarily difficult to remove." That phrase is doing a lot of work with very little precision. Read practically, it means metadata alone probably isn't enough, because C2PA manifests get stripped by ordinary platform processing and a screenshot destroys them entirely. Which is exactly why the industry has converged on layering a pixel watermark underneath the metadata.
Now the hole: text. Both the manifest and latent disclosure obligations are limited by statute to "image, video, or audio content, or content that is any combination thereof." An essay ChatGPT wrote for you, a report Claude drafted, a landing page Gemini generated — this law asks nothing of any of it. That's a concession to technical reality. Text watermarking works by biasing token selection statistically, and the signal degrades badly under paraphrase or a pass through a second model, while false positives have already caused real harm in academic-integrity settings. But the consequence is a coverage gap you could drive a truck through. Election disinformation, fabricated news articles, bulk astroturfing — the domains where text is the weapon remain entirely unregulated by this statute.
One more provision people skip: licensee control. If a covered provider licenses its model to a third party and that licensee disables the disclosure capabilities, the provider must revoke the license within 96 hours of discovering it, and the licensee must stop using the revoked system. That single clause pulls the entire API-reseller ecosystem into the compliance perimeter. If you white-label someone else's image model, your upstream provider now has a contractual and statutory reason to police what you do with it.
| Item | Substance | Basis |
|---|---|---|
| Statute | California AI Transparency Act (SB 942), amended by AB 853 | leginfo bill texts |
| Code location | Business and Professions Code §22757 et seq. | AB 853 amends/adds §22757.1–22757.6 |
| Operative date | August 2, 2026 (originally January 1, 2026) | AB 853, amendment to §22757.6 |
| Who's covered | Producers of publicly accessible genAI systems with 1,000,000+ monthly visitors or users | §22757.1 "covered provider" |
| Duty 1 | Free, publicly accessible AI detection tool with upload and API access | §22757.2 |
| Duty 2 | User option to attach a visible (manifest) AI disclosure | §22757.3 |
| Duty 3 | Embedded latent, machine-readable disclosure in image, video, audio | §22757.3; text excluded |
| Licensee rule | Revoke license within 96 hours of discovering disclosure features disabled | §22757.3 |
| Penalty | $5,000 per violation; each day of violation is a separate violation | §22757.4 |
| Enforcement | Attorney General, city attorneys, county counsel; prevailing plaintiff recovers fees | §22757.4 |
| Jan 1, 2027 | Large online platforms (2,000,000+ unique monthly users) and genAI hosting platforms | AB 853, new §22757.3.1, §22757.3.2 |
| Jan 1, 2028 | Capture device manufacturers must offer and default-embed latent disclosure | AB 853, new §22757.3.3 |
Who Wins, Who Eats the Cost
The clearest winners are the companies that already paid for provenance. Adobe essentially founded the Content Credentials movement and has shipped that metadata in Firefly from the start. OpenAI closed the gap in May with simultaneous C2PA conformance and SynthID adoption and a public verification tool. Google owns SynthID outright and, in a nice piece of ecosystem strategy, got OpenAI to adopt it. For all three, August 2 isn't a new cost — it's the day a cost they already absorbed converts into a competitive moat. This is the oldest pattern in regulatory economics: the firm that prepaid compliance benefits when compliance becomes mandatory for everyone else.
The clearest losers are mid-sized generative AI startups. Think about how low a threshold one million monthly users actually is. A half-viral image app clears that in a quarter. The moment you cross it, you owe a detection tool with an API, a watermarking pipeline in your inference path, a manifest-disclosure UI, and a licensee monitoring program. Add it up and that's a couple of dedicated engineers plus ongoing infrastructure. Worse, the statute doesn't precisely specify how you count monthly users in California, so companies hovering near the line have to make a judgment call about whether to build compliance at all. That ambiguity is itself a tax that falls hardest on small operators.
Open-weight AI sits in a genuinely awkward spot. The generative AI hosting platform provisions that switch on January 1, 2027 target websites that make model weights or source code available for download, and they prohibit those platforms from knowingly distributing systems that lack the required disclosure capabilities. The trouble is that once someone downloads weights and runs them locally, nobody can enforce a watermark — you delete a few lines and it's gone. So in practice the clause functions as a review burden imposed on distribution hubs rather than an actual constraint on output. For the open-weight ecosystem, 2027 is the real test, and how the major model hubs interpret "knowingly" will shape a lot.
Ordinary users are nominally the beneficiaries here. In theory you can now take a suspicious image, drop it into a free tool, and learn which model produced it and when. In practice it'll be messier than that, because each provider builds a tool that checks only its own outputs. OpenAI says as much about Verify — it confirms whether OpenAI-associated provenance signals are present, and it makes no claim about images from other generators. So verifying an image of unknown origin means walking it through a queue of separate tools, one per vendor. A right to verify without a unified place to exercise it is half a right.
And there's a quieter set of losers: people harmed by text-based synthetic content. This law was designed around deepfake images and cloned voices, which is a defensible priority — those cause visceral, documented harm. But the volume weapon in information operations right now is text. Fake reviews, bot-account posts, auto-generated news farms. Nothing that switched on August 2 touches any of it. Legislators know this and have left room to expand later, but nobody has put a date on that expansion, and I'd be careful about assuming one is coming soon.
California Has Run This Play Before — Twice Well, Twice Badly
The obvious success story is CCPA. Passed in 2018, effective in 2020, the California Consumer Privacy Act became the de facto national privacy standard in the continued absence of federal legislation. The logic was pure economics: maintaining a separate data-handling pipeline for a 40-million-person market costs more than just applying the strict rules everywhere. So most firms applied California's rules nationally. Then other states followed — Colorado and Virginia in 2021, Connecticut and Utah in 2022, then Delaware, Indiana, Iowa, Montana, Oregon, Tennessee, and Texas. That cascade is called the California Effect, and it is precisely the outcome SB 942's supporters are betting on.
The second success is older and structurally instructive: vehicle emissions standards. California received authority under the 1970 Clean Air Act to set its own standards, and those standards ended up constraining the design of the entire American auto industry, because no manufacturer was going to build one engine for California and another for the other 49 states. The lesson generalizes cleanly: regulation that lodges inside product architecture propagates past jurisdictional borders. Watermarking is exactly that kind of regulation. Once you insert a provenance-signing step into an image generation pipeline, conditionally disabling it based on the user's IP geolocation is more work than just leaving it on.
Now the failures. The first is California's own Age-Appropriate Design Code Act (AB 2273). Passed in 2022, it imposed data protection impact assessments and default settings on services likely accessed by children. NetChoice sued on First Amendment grounds and got substantial portions enjoined in federal court. The lesson is blunt: California passing a law is not the same as California having a working law, and the moment a statute brushes against speech, the U.S. Constitution becomes a very heavy obstacle. SB 942's structure — the government requiring private parties to attach particular disclosures to expressive output — is at least arguably in compelled-speech territory.
The second failure is a different flavor of the same disease: cookie consent banners. GDPR's consent requirement was principled and the implementation gave the world a decade of pop-ups that everyone dismisses reflexively. The formal requirement was met; the intended outcome never arrived. Provenance watermarking can fall into the identical trap — every image carries credentials, nobody checks them, the people who do check don't know how to interpret what they see, and the actual bad actors run unwatermarked open weights on their own hardware. Which is why a growing chunk of the provenance community argues the decisive battleground isn't statutory text at all. It's viewer UX: whether verification shows up where people already look, in one click, in plain language.
How the Other Side Fights Back
The biggest counter-move is already underway. On December 11, 2025, President Trump signed an executive order titled "Ensuring a National Policy Framework for Artificial Intelligence," aimed at preempting state AI laws deemed inconsistent with federal deregulatory policy. It directed the Attorney General to stand up an AI Litigation Task Force to challenge state AI laws in federal court, including on dormant Commerce Clause and preemption theories. The Task Force began operating January 10, 2026. The Secretary of Commerce was directed to publish an evaluation identifying burdensome state AI laws by March 11, 2026, and the FTC was directed to issue a policy statement by the same date addressing when state laws requiring alteration of truthful outputs are preempted by federal law on deceptive practices.
But here's the thing: as of August 2026, no statutory federal preemption has been enacted. Congress hasn't passed a law preempting state AI regulation, and an executive order alone cannot nullify a state statute. So the current equilibrium is awkward — the administration applies litigation pressure while state laws remain in force. Law firm analyses have converged on roughly the same read: existing California AI laws are unlikely to be knocked out in the near term. That said, litigation risk is already distorting corporate behavior in a measurable way. The internal argument "why are we staffing engineers against a law that might get struck down in six months" is happening in a lot of compliance meetings right now, and uncertainty is a very effective way to slow compliance without ever winning a case.
The industry's second card is the technical infeasibility defense. The argument TechNet and CCIA made in 2024 — that watermarking is immature — will get a second life in litigation, and the statutory phrase "permanent or extraordinarily difficult to remove" is the obvious attack surface. No existing watermark survives a determined adversary. Research on adversarial watermark removal keeps landing, and a combination of cropping, resizing, recompression, and generative reconstruction degrades a lot of signals. For providers, the operational question becomes where to draw the "we made a reasonable, standards-conformant effort" line, because nobody can promise permanence and the statute more or less asks for it.
The third card is regulatory fragmentation as an argument. Texas, Colorado, and Illinois all have their own AI statutes with materially different requirements. Industry has consistently used that patchwork to argue for a uniform federal standard, and there's a strategic calculation buried in it: the messier the state landscape, the stronger the case for federal cleanup, and federal standards historically land looser than the strictest state's. That's not cynicism, it's just the pattern from more than a decade of the privacy legislation wars, and everyone involved knows the playbook.
The last counter-play is the quietest and probably the most effective: selective non-compliance. The large providers are done or nearly done. What remains is a long tail of smaller operators for whom individual enforcement is a low priority. The Attorney General's office has finite resources, and city attorneys don't have any obvious reason to make AI watermarking their top docket item. So the realistic near-term picture is a law that exists but is barely enforced. Which means the single most informative event on the horizon isn't a court ruling — it's the first enforcement action, whenever it comes and against whomever it targets. That case will set the real price of non-compliance. Until it lands, everyone's watching everyone else.
So What Actually Changes
If you're a developer, your checklist is short and concrete. One: does your product clear a million monthly users in California? If yes, the clock started Sunday. Two: do you generate or materially alter images, video, or audio? If you're text-only, the disclosure duties don't reach you. Three: metadata or pixel watermark? The emerging practical answer is both — C2PA manifests carry rich information but strip easily, pixel watermarks carry little information but survive transformation, and they're complementary rather than competing. Four, and this is the one teams miss: the detection tool has to expose an API, not just a web upload form. A pretty verification page is not compliance.
If you're an investor, there are two things worth watching. The first is compliance-as-a-market. Companies selling provenance infrastructure, C2PA signing key management, and verification-as-a-service now have a regulatory calendar that doubles as a revenue calendar, and the calendar has steps in it: covered providers now, large online platforms and hosting platforms on January 1, 2027, capture device manufacturers on January 1, 2028. The second is the risk side. If a portfolio company is scaling fast on image or voice generation, crossing the million-user line creates unbudgeted engineering debt at exactly the moment the team wants to be shipping features instead.
If you're a regular user, the honest answer is that you won't feel much this week. Maybe one extra toggle in your image generator, maybe a couple of new verification sites. The meaningful change is slower and structural: the burden of proof is shifting. Until now, "is this AI?" was a question nobody could answer. Going forward, content from major models will have a checkable path, and content without any provenance signal starts to become suspicious because it has none. That's a genuinely different information environment, and it arrives gradually rather than on a single Sunday.
If you're an enterprise or institution, this is less a new compliance program than a new row in an existing one. Users in California means SB 942. Training a frontier model means SB 53 — effective January 1, 2026, covering models trained above 10^26 FLOPs, requiring a published frontier AI framework, transparency reports at deployment, critical safety incident reporting, and carrying penalties up to $1 million per violation. Selling into Europe means AI Act Article 50. Those three requirement sets overlap substantially, so building three separate compliance stacks is waste. Build one provenance data schema and map it to all three.
Finally, the verification-heavy fields: journalism, education, and litigation. These are the constituencies that should get the most out of a mandated free detection tool, and they're also the ones who'll hit its limits fastest, because per-vendor tools don't compose. Somebody is going to build the aggregation layer that queries all of them at once — the interesting question is whether that somebody is a government, a standards body, or a startup. Worth noting for contrast: the EU's Article 50 transparency obligations came into application the very same day, but the EU approach centers on disclosure duties without requiring providers to build public detection tools. On verification infrastructure specifically, California went further than Brussels.
🥄 Three Things You're Probably Wondering
— So what does this mean for me? If you're just using ChatGPT or Midjourney, you owe nothing legally. But when providers rebuild their pipelines for California, those changes generally ship globally rather than being geofenced. Expect the AI images you download to start carrying invisible origin data wherever you live.
— Why is this happening now specifically? The original date was January 1 of this year; AB 853 moved it to August 2. That's the same day the EU AI Act's Article 50 transparency obligations came into application, which looks like deliberate alignment so companies face one deadline instead of two.
— Why does text get a pass, and will that change? Text watermarking breaks under a single paraphrase and produces false positives that cause real harm, so lawmakers judged it too immature to mandate. They've left room to expand later, but no timeline has been confirmed. Too early to call.
